Job SummaryJob DescriptionWhat is the opportunity?As the Senior Manager, Pricing and Analytics, you will be responsible for the development and management of pricing strategies to drive profitable growth and increased market share for the Personal Lending (PL) portfolios. The Senior Manager of Pricing & Analytics is responsible for the development and end-to-end implementation of pricing strategies, including providing actionable insights and recommendations to senior leadership to drive growth and profitability.What will you do?Develop and maintain origination pricing strategies for Unsecured Lines of Credit, Education Financing and Installment loans to ensure an optimal balance between profitability and acquisition volumesIdentify and execute on price optimization opportunities for revolving credit product portfolios to achieve profitability targets and improve KPIsMonitor competitor activity and develop benchmarking to inform pricing strategiesWork closely with partner groups to manage the pricing lifecycle (strategy, execution, performance monitoring and refinement) for all PL productsSupport the analytics needs of the PL business, including developing a deeper understanding of segment economics and customer behaviour, support for business cases, deep dives on new product innovation and special projectsProvide ad hoc analysis with actionable insights to enable strategic, fact-based discussions and facilitate better decision-making within PLWhat do you need to succeed?Must have:3+ years related work experience developing pricing and financial modellingProgramming experience to extract data and complete complex analytics. SAS / SQL required. R, Python, etc. preferredExperience developing reporting and dashboards using Tableau or similar softwareStrong leadership and interpersonal skillsStrategic mindset and ability to own the development and execution of pricing strategies and playbooksAbility to demonstrate proficiency for critical thinking and unpacking ambiguityStrong written and verbal communication skills, leveraging data and insights to tell a storyNice to have:Bachelor’s/Master’s degree in a quantitative field is preferred but not required (e.g. Engineering, Physics, Mathematics, Statistics, etc.)Strong understanding of financial concepts including cost of funds, funds transfer pricing, etc.Previous experience in credit risk including risk modeling and credit strategy developmentKnowledge and experience developing statistical models including linear & logistic regression, survival models, decision trees, neural nets, cluster analysis, etc. and applying their output in practical strategiesWhat’s in it for you?We thrive on the challenge to be our best, progressive thinking to keep growing, and working together to deliver trusted advice to help our clients thrive and communities prosper.
